How to Choose the Right Facial Oil Based on Your Skin Type
The selection of the ideal facial vegetable oil depends closely on your skin type and specific needs. Oily and acne-prone skin will benefit from non-comedogenic oils like jojoba or argan, while dry skin will appreciate nourishing oils like rosehip or almond oil. Sensitive and mature skin will find their match in antioxidant-rich oils like nigella.
It’s also important to consider the time of year for oil use. In winter, opt for richer, more nourishing oils, while in summer, choose lighter, non-greasy oils to avoid drying effects.
The Benefits of Vegetable Oils for the Skin
Vegetable oils play a crucial role in skin hydration and protection. They form a protective barrier that prevents water evaporation and protects against external factors. Additionally, they contain natural antioxidants that fight free radicals, thereby slowing down skin aging.
Vegetable oils can also help treat certain skin conditions like acne, irritations, or eczema. However, it’s essential to choose an oil suitable for your skin type and avoid overuse, which could lead to unwanted effects like pore clogging.
Quality and Safety of Vegetable Oils
The quality of vegetable oils can vary depending on their source, extraction method, and storage. It’s recommended to choose certified organic or sustainably produced oils to ensure their safety and effectiveness.
Additionally, it’s important to check the production date and storage instructions on the label. Vegetable oils should be stored in a cool, dark environment to preserve their active properties.
